tmpfs 文件系统已满。需要帮助来增加此容量或删除不需要的软件

tmpfs 文件系统已满。需要帮助来增加此容量或删除不需要的软件

几乎不知所措。使用 Plesk 运行快速服务器已有几年了。托管我们自己的网站和服务。在过去的几天里,我注意到了很多问题,但没有想到检查可用文件空间。昨晚检查时,我得到了:

[root@server ~]# df -H
Filesystem      Size  Used Avail Use% Mounted on
rootfs           22G   21G     0 100% /
/dev/root        22G   21G     0 100% /
devtmpfs         34G  238k   34G   1% /dev
/dev/sda2       136G  7.4G  121G   6% /var
tmpfs            34G     0   34G   0% /dev/shm
/dev/root        22G   21G     0 100% /var/named/chroot/etc/named
/dev/sda2       136G  7.4G  121G   6% /var/named/chroot/var/named
/dev/root        22G   21G     0 100% /var/named/chroot/etc/named.rfc1912.zones
/dev/root        22G   21G     0 100% /var/named/chroot/etc/rndc.key
/dev/root        22G   21G     0 100% /var/named/chroot/usr/lib64/bind
/dev/root        22G   21G     0 100% /var/named/chroot/etc/named.iscdlv.key
/dev/root        22G   21G     0 100% /var/named/chroot/etc/named.root.key

我对服务器系统相当了解,但无法得到任何答案,比如是什么填满了这个空间,如何删除它。或者,增加 rootfs 大小;如果可能的话。与此相关的可能是,我的备份不见了!在已安装的 NAS 上。一直在使用 rsync 和自定义 msqlbackup 脚本来执行此操作,但过去几天服务器上的操作有点混乱。有什么指示可以告诉我该怎么做吗?我搜索了这里和其他网站上的其他帖子,但没有一个可以帮助我确定我可以做什么。我真的很感谢你的帮助。谢谢

一些进一步的信息:fdisk -l 的输出:

Device Boot      Start         End      Blocks   Id  System
/dev/sda1   *           1        2612    20971520   83  Linux
/dev/sda2            2612       19324   134244352   83  Linux
/dev/sda3           19324       19390      525312   82  Linux swap / Solaris

/etc/fstab 的内容:

/dev/sda1       /       ext4    errors=remount-ro       0       1
/dev/sda2       /var    ext4    defaults        0       2
/dev/sda3       none    swap    defaults        0       0
proc            /proc   proc    defaults                0       0
sysfs           /sys    sysfs   defaults                0       0
tmpfs           /dev/shm        tmpfs   defaults        0       0
devpts          /dev/pts        devpts  defaults        0       0
10.16.101.3:/nas-000009/mininas-001783 /mnt nfs rw 0    0

进入恢复并删除一些日志文件以清除一点空间后, df -h 的输出奇怪地不同:

Filesystem      Size  Used Avail Use% Mounted on
rootfs           20G   20G     0 100% /
/dev/root        20G   20G     0 100% /
devtmpfs         32G  232K   32G   1% /dev
/dev/sda2       126G  6.6G  113G   6% /var
tmpfs            32G     0   32G   0% /dev/shm
/dev/root        20G   20G     0 100% /var/named/chroot/etc/named
/dev/sda2       126G  6.6G  113G   6% /var/named/chroot/var/named
/dev/root        20G   20G     0 100% /var/named/chroot/etc/named.rfc1912.zones
/dev/root        20G   20G     0 100% /var/named/chroot/etc/rndc.key
/dev/root        20G   20G     0 100% /var/named/chroot/usr/lib64/bind
/dev/root        20G   20G     0 100% /var/named/chroot/etc/named.iscdlv.key
/dev/root        20G   20G     0 100% /var/named/chroot/etc/named.root.key

rootfs 现在只有 20GB 大小,使用率为 100%。内容是否动态更改?

答案1

在 Iain 的帮助下,我发现挂载的网络附加存储已经消失。所有备份都被写入 /rootfs,很快就填满了。我只需要弄清楚为什么会发生这种情况,并确保它不会再次发生。

相关内容